Астана, проспект Туран, 19/2
Компания Bultech разрабатывает SaaS-платформу для бизнес-автоматизации на базе ИИ.
Мы объединяем WhatsApp, Telegram, Instagram, TikTok и CRM — чтобы бизнес мог автоматизировать коммуникации, продажи и поддержку через единый API,
Обязанности:
— Разработка и поддержка клиентской части системы на Next.js (React).
— Создание адаптивных и отзывчивых интерфейсов (Dashboards, чаты, аналитика).
— Взаимодействие с Backend через REST API и WebSockets (реализация real-time функционала).
— Управление состоянием приложения (сложные формы, списки, кэширование данных).
— Оптимизация производительности рендеринга и скорости загрузки страниц.
— Участие в проектировании архитектуры фронтенда и выборе библиотек.
— Взаимодействие с командой дизайна (Figma) и бэкенда.
Требования:
— Коммерческий опыт Frontend-разработки от 2 лет.
— Отличное знание JavaScript (ES6+) и TypeScript.
— Глубокое понимание React (Hooks, Context, Lifecycle) и фреймворка Next.js (SSR/SSG).
— Опыт работы со стейт-менеджерами (Redux Toolkit, Zustand или аналоги).
— Уверенное понимание работы с WebSockets (важно для чатов и уведомлений в CRM).
— Умение верстать адаптивно и кроссбраузерно (SCSS / Tailwind CSS / Styled Components).
— Понимание принципов работы протоколов HTTP/HTTPS.
Будет плюсом:
— Опыт коммерческой разработки на Vue.js (или готовность периодически взаимодействовать с кодом на Vue).
— Опыт работы с библиотеками UI-компонентов (Chakra, Material UI, Shadcn).
— Навыки работы с графиками и визуализацией данных
— Понимание принципов CI/CD (Docker, GitLab CI).
Условия:
— Конкурентная зарплата (обсуждается индивидуально)
— Формат работы: офис /гибрид.
— Локация: Астана.
— Испытательный срок: 2 месяца.
— График: 9:00-18:00.